Output 2ea6ad155be07e8226743f239f14826c1c5e276c2b0fee64cce7f3a2fedba367:5

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a4118a11b184f8d874b1cf639900d0eac3f2fa OP_EQUAL
address
3B3jPnooRgvxUZNmQW8Yfa75wiYfTKdyHk
transaction
2ea6ad155be07e8226743f239f14826c1c5e276c2b0fee64cce7f3a2fedba367
confirmations
195950
spent
true